Job description

Company Overview

Moog Aircraft Services Asia (MASA), a joint venture between Moog Inc and SIA Engineering Company, provides Maintenance, Repair, and Overhaul services for Moog flight control systems on new generation aircraft including Boeing 787 and Airbus A350.

Job Summary

The Workshop Technician reports to the Operations Manager and performs critical testing, repair, and troubleshooting of flight control actuations to ensure product safety and customer satisfaction while optimizing repair efficiency and cost-effectiveness.

Responsibilities
  • Conduct testing, repair, and troubleshooting of flight control actuation systems to ensure safety and compliance with customer requirements
  • Monitor and control shop processes to maintain operational efficiency and quality standards
  • Implement safety management practices and apply human factors principles to minimize risks in the workshop
  • Accurately document technical data and input information into company systems for traceability and reporting
  • Perform preventive maintenance on workshop equipment to ensure reliability and minimize downtime
  • Lead and participate in continuous improvement initiatives to enhance repair processes and reduce costs
  • Analyze technical problems promptly to identify root causes and recommend corrective actions
  • Apply critical thinking to develop innovative solutions and process improvements for complex issues
  • Maintain high attention to detail by identifying and addressing technical discrepancies and quality concerns
  • Utilize numerical skills to perform statistical and data analysis supporting quality control and process optimization
  • Communicate complex technical information clearly and effectively in writing and verbally to diverse audiences, including internal teams and external stakeholders
  • Collaborate effectively within the operations team and coordinate with other departments, suppliers, and customers to achieve operational goals
Preferred competencies and qualifications
  • Diploma or NITEC in Aerospace, Aviation Science, or Engineering discipline
  • Aviation industry experience preferred
  • Possession of aviation regulatory certifications is a plus
